Non-Physical Gift Ideas for Father’s Day
Not every great gift comes in a box. If you’re looking for thoughtful, last-minute, or experience-based options, here’s a quick guide to non-physical gifts Dad will still remember long after the day is done:
Dad and Older Kids Outing
For grown kids who haven’t had as much time with Dad lately, plan a special day together. Think: dinner and a comedy show, a visit to a winery or brewery with live music, or a hike followed by a picnic. It’s about reconnecting and making memories.
Spa Day
Let Dad unwind with a well-deserved spa experience. Local favorites like Woodhouse, Anda Spa, or Läka Spa offer relaxing treatments that will leave him feeling refreshed and appreciated.
Subscription Services
Give a gift that keeps on giving — monthly book boxes, craft beer or wine deliveries, coffee clubs, or novelty snack subscriptions add a little surprise and delight to his routine.
Experiences Over Things
Whether he’s the adventurous type or prefers laid-back fun, gifting an experience is always a win. Consider skydiving, golf, game or concert tickets, axe throwing, or a class in something new like cooking, curling, or indoor climbing.
And if you can’t be with your dad this Father’s Day, don’t underestimate the power of a FaceTime call — hearing how much he’s loved and appreciated is always the best part of his day.
